In my case this was happening because I was binding to a List of custom objects.Note A common mistake that a lot of people do is that they perform a databind each and every-time the Page_Load method is called.Within the Item Template I have an Image Buttong with a Command Name of "Edit".This works as expected and I can put a breakpoint in the Row Command event handler to see the "Event" command name.It's the control's responsibility to add its contents to viewstate. Find Control("control Name"); to get the control in the row.
aspdotnet-suresh offers C#articles and tutorials,csharp dot net,articles and tutorials, VB. the good old problem of getting the data from the row that is being currently edited within a Grid View. Accessing the "Controls": This method gets you access to the control in the Grid View, which might be useful based on what you are doing.Obviously the simplest method is to use Data Key Names on the Grid View and then you should have the data in your Grid View Update Event Args as part of e. (In the following example, I cast to a Check Box as I know I have a checkbox at the col Index You Are Interested In - you should cast to whatever control you have in that column).I am trying to do some dynamic stuff with my Grid View, so I have wired up some code to the Row Data Bound event. I am trying to get the value from a particular cell, which is a Template Field. My problem lies in that the click on the Update Image Button posts back, but neither the Row Command nor Row Updating events get triggered.